T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to cigarette stirring equipment technical field, especially a kind of power device of stirrer. BACKGROUND

[0002] At present, the power device of cigarette stirring equipment generally adopts horizontal installation DC motor, and the motor shaft is coaxially arranged with the main shaft in the transmission box of stirring equipment, and the output end of motor is partially immersed in oil pool. When the output end of motor rotates, the lubricating oil in transmission box splashes, which causes the lubricating oil to easily invade the interior of DC motor along the motor shaft, thereby causing motor failure. [0026] It should be noted that the transmission box 4 is provided with lubricating oil for lubricating the connecting part and rotating part, and the liquid level of the oil pool 5 is generally lower than half of the transmission box 4.

[0027] Please refer to Figure 1 In order to solve the above problems, the utility model provides a power device of a stirring machine, which comprises a driving member 1, a transmission assembly 2 and a transmission box 4. The transmission assembly 2 is in transmission connection with the driving member 1 in the transmission box 4 loaded with lubricating oil. The lower part of the transmission assembly 2 is immersed in an oil pool 5. The output end of the driving member 1 is suspended above the liquid level of the oil pool 5. The installation position of the driving member 1 specifically comprises:

[0028] As an implementable mode, the driving member 1 is arranged on the side plate of the transmission box 4, that is, the fixed end of the driving member 1 is arranged on the side plate of the transmission box 4. The driving shaft of the driving member 1 extends into the interior of the transmission box 4 from the side plate of the transmission box 4. The driving shaft is in transmission connection with the transmission box 4, and the driving shaft is arranged higher than the liquid level of the oil pool 5.

[0029] As another implementable mode, the driving member 1 is arranged on the top plate of the transmission box 4, that is, the fixed end of the driving member 1 is arranged on the top plate of the transmission box 4. The driving shaft of the driving member 1 extends into the interior of the transmission box 4 from the top plate of the transmission box 4. The driving shaft is in transmission connection with the transmission box 4, and the driving shaft is arranged higher than the liquid level of the oil pool 5.

[0030] For example, the driving member 1 can be a direct current motor. The motor base is detachably fixed on the top plate of the transmission box 4. The driving shaft of the motor is located in the interior of the transmission box 4. The top end of the driving shaft is in transmission connection with the stirring assembly 3 through the transmission assembly 2, so that the motor drives the stirring assembly 3 to operate.

[0031] Please refer to Figure 1 In one embodiment of the present application, the transmission assembly 2 comprises a transmission member 21, a rotating member 22 and a transmission rod 23, the driving member 1 drives the transmission rod 23 to rotate through the transmission member 21, the rotating member 22 is sleeved on the outer periphery of the transmission rod 23, and the lower part of the transmission member 21 is immersed in the oil pool 5.

[0032] Specifically, the transmission rod 23 is horizontally arranged in the transmission box 4, and the rotating member 22 is coaxially arranged with the transmission rod 23. The transmission member 21 comprises a first transmission wheel 211 and a second transmission wheel 212. The driving member 1 is in transmission connection with the first transmission wheel 211. The second transmission wheel 212 is arranged at the end of the transmission rod 23 and is in meshing with the first transmission wheel 211. The first transmission wheel 211 is suspended above the liquid level of the oil pool 5. The lower part of the second transmission wheel 212 is immersed in the oil pool 5. The meshing point of the first transmission wheel 211 and the second transmission wheel 212 is arranged above the liquid level of the oil pool 5. When the driving member 1 drives the first transmission wheel 211 to rotate, the first transmission wheel 211 drives the second transmission wheel 212 to rotate, so that the transmission rod 23 synchronously rotates with the second transmission wheel 212. The first transmission wheel 211 is suspended above the oil pool 5, and the lower end of the second transmission wheel 212 is immersed in the oil pool 5, so that the second transmission wheel 212 brings lubricating oil to the first transmission wheel 211 through the meshing with the first transmission wheel 211, achieving the purpose of lubricating the first transmission wheel 211.

[0042] Please refer to Figure 1 In one embodiment of the present application, an annular sliding groove 221 is formed on the outer periphery of the rotating member 22, and the sliding block 31 is in sliding connection with the sliding groove 221, so that when the rotating member 22 rotates, the inner side wall of the sliding groove 221 pushes the sliding block 31 to slide along the sliding direction of the sliding groove 221 and make reciprocating motion, so that the first swing rod 321 and the second swing rod 323 are synchronously reciprocated. The structure of the sliding groove 221 specifically includes:

[0043] As an implementation, the sliding groove 221 can be an elliptical annular groove, which is inclinedly formed on the outer periphery of the rotating member 22, that is, the rotating member 22 can be a cylindrical cam provided with an inclined annular groove, and the sliding block 31 can be a cylindrical body, the lower end of which is embedded in the annular groove and in sliding fit with the inner wall of the annular groove. When the cylindrical cam rotates, the inner wall of the annular groove pushes the cylindrical body to run along the sliding direction of the annular groove, so that the first swing rod 321 swings around the transmission shaft 322 as the rotation axis, and the transmission shaft 322 drives the second swing rod 323 to swing.

[0044] As a preferred embodiment, the sliding groove 221 can be a continuous and wavy annular groove, that is, the rotating member 22 can be a cylindrical cam provided with a continuous and wavy annular groove. When the cylindrical cam rotates, the inner wall of the annular groove pushes the cylindrical body to run along the sliding direction of the annular groove, so that the first swing rod 321 swings around the transmission shaft 322 as the rotation axis, and the transmission shaft 322 drives the second swing rod 323 to swing.

[0045] It can be understood that the shape of the sliding groove 221 can be adaptively adjusted according to actual application conditions, and the sliding block 31 can be driven to make reciprocating motion in the sliding groove 221.

[0046] It should be noted that the blender is provided with a stirring roller for stirring the cigarettes falling into the lower cigarette channel, the stirring assembly 3 is used to drive the stirring roller to run, and the pull rod 324 is in transmission connection with the stirring roller.

[0047] The working steps of the power device of the application specifically include:

[0048] Firstly, the driving member 1 drives the first transmission wheel 211 to rotate, the first transmission wheel 211 drives the second transmission wheel 212 to rotate, at the same time, the transmission rod 23 arranged on the second transmission wheel 212 rotates with the second transmission wheel 212, the part of the second transmission wheel 212 immersed in the oil pool 5 rolls up the lubricating oil and lubricates the first transmission wheel 211 through the engagement with the first transmission wheel 211, then, the rotating member 22 arranged on the transmission rod 23 rotates with the transmission rod 23, the sliding block 31 arranged in the sliding groove 221 is pushed by the inner wall of the sliding groove 221 and runs along the direction of the sliding groove 221, reciprocatingly swings relative to the ground, the sliding block 31 drives the transmission shaft 322 to reciprocate through the first swing rod 321, then, the second swing rod 323 swings synchronously reciprocatingly with the transmission shaft 322 as the rotating shaft, so that the pull rod 324 drives the stirring roller to reciprocate, that is, to rotate clockwise or counterclockwise reciprocatingly, so as to achieve the purpose of stirring the cigarettes.
